Abstract
The indications for two types of pulsed Nd: YAG lasers in the treatment of vitreous pathology are reviewed. A series of 94 eyes from 93 patients were treated with the mode-locked system and 72 eyes from 71 patients were treated with the Q-switched system. A classification of vitreous pathology with prognostic value for the efficacy of treatment of both lasers is established. For the Q-switched laser the range of indications in the posterior pole is larger and fewer sessions are needed; however, complications are more frequent than with the mode-locked laser. This difference is due to the higher energy needed with the Q-switched laser to treat more severe vitreous pathology.Entities:
